用数据库开发的程序叫什么

fiy 其他 4

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    用数据库开发的程序通常被称为数据库管理系统(Database Management System,简称DBMS)。DBMS是一种软件工具,用于创建、管理和操作数据库。它提供了一种组织、存储和检索大量数据的有效方式,并提供了一些功能,如数据完整性、安全性和并发控制。

    以下是关于数据库开发程序的五个主要方面:

    1. 数据库设计:在数据库开发过程中,首先需要进行数据库设计。这包括确定数据库的结构、表格、字段和关系。数据库设计人员使用建模工具(如ER图)来可视化数据库的结构,并使用数据库规范语言(如SQL)来创建和定义数据库对象。

    2. 数据库管理:数据库管理是数据库开发的核心任务之一。它涉及到创建、删除、修改和管理数据库中的数据。数据库管理人员使用DBMS提供的功能来执行这些任务,例如插入、更新、删除和查询数据。

    3. 数据库安全:数据库开发程序需要确保数据的安全性和保密性。这包括使用访问控制机制来限制对数据库的访问,并设置密码和权限以保护敏感数据。此外,数据库开发人员还需要定期备份数据库以防止数据丢失,并在发生故障时恢复数据。

    4. 数据库优化:数据库开发程序还需要进行性能优化,以确保数据库的高效运行。这包括选择合适的数据结构、索引和查询优化技术,以提高查询速度和减少资源消耗。数据库开发人员还可以使用性能监控工具来监测数据库的性能,并进行必要的调整和优化。

    5. 数据库扩展:随着数据量的增加,数据库开发程序需要进行扩展以满足需求。这包括水平扩展和垂直扩展。水平扩展涉及将数据库分布在多个服务器上,以提高系统的可伸缩性和负载均衡性。垂直扩展涉及增加服务器的处理能力和存储容量,以支持更大规模的数据处理。

    总之,数据库开发程序是用于创建、管理和操作数据库的软件工具。它涉及数据库设计、管理、安全、优化和扩展等方面的任务。通过正确使用数据库开发程序,可以有效地组织和处理大量的数据,并提供高效的数据访问和查询功能。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    用数据库开发的程序一般称为数据库应用程序或数据库管理系统(DBMS)。数据库应用程序是指基于数据库技术开发的软件程序,用于管理和操作数据库中的数据。数据库管理系统是指用于管理和操作数据库的软件系统,包括数据存储、数据查询、数据备份和恢复、用户管理等功能。常见的数据库管理系统包括MySQL、Oracle、Microsoft SQL Server、PostgreSQL等。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    使用数据库进行开发的程序通常被称为数据库应用程序或数据库管理系统(DBMS)。数据库应用程序是指通过编程语言与数据库进行交互,实现数据的存储、检索、更新和管理的软件系统。常见的数据库应用程序包括企业资源规划系统(ERP)、客户关系管理系统(CRM)、电子商务平台、学生管理系统等。

    下面是一个用数据库开发程序的基本操作流程:

    1. 设计数据库结构:首先需要根据应用程序的需求设计数据库的结构。这包括确定实体(表)、属性(字段)和关系(关联)等。

    2. 创建数据库:在数据库管理系统中创建一个新的数据库,将设计好的数据库结构转化为实际的数据库。

    3. 连接数据库:使用编程语言(如Java、Python、C#等)编写代码,通过数据库连接器连接到数据库。

    4. 数据操作:通过编程语言提供的数据库操作接口,实现数据的增加、删除、修改和查询等操作。这些操作可以使用结构化查询语言(SQL)或者面向对象的数据库操作语言(如Hibernate、Entity Framework等)来执行。

    5. 数据库事务:对于需要保证数据的一致性和完整性的操作,可以使用数据库事务来管理。数据库事务是指一系列操作组成的逻辑单元,要么全部成功,要么全部失败,保证数据的一致性。

    6. 数据库安全性:为了保护数据库的安全性,可以采取一些安全措施,如设置访问权限、加密敏感数据、备份与恢复数据等。

    7. 数据库优化:对于大型数据库或者需要高性能的应用程序,需要进行数据库优化,以提高数据的访问和处理效率。优化包括索引的创建、查询语句的优化、表的分区等。

    8. 测试和调试:完成数据库应用程序的开发后,需要进行测试和调试,确保程序的功能和性能达到预期。

    总之,数据库应用程序的开发需要从数据库设计、编程语言选择、数据库操作、安全性和性能优化等方面综合考虑,以实现高效、安全和可靠的数据库应用程序。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部